3. €œLust-Mad Men And Lawless Women In A Vicious And Sensous Orgy Of Slaughter!€ - Five Bloody Graves

With their thrifty budgets, washed-up performers and overreliance on stock footage, Al Adamson€™s cheap and cheerful pictures perfectly sum up the trash that was playing rural Drive-Ins in the '60s and '70s. Five Bloody Graves is a thoroughly unremarkable film and, unusually for Adamson, it€™s a western, but otherwise his trademarks are present and correct. Loaded with stock music you€™ve heard in dozens of other features and with a cast comprised entirely of the filmmaker€™s friends (leading man Robert Dix also wrote the script), this is for aficionados only.
